I had this issue in 14b1 as well. Audio playback is perfect in the edit tab, but upon switiching to the fairlight tab, it's as if there's nothing there. Playback doesn't work.

I tried making sure that the tracks are routed to the master out, building aux busses, all the routing I could come up with.

I've also tried on multiple projects and have the same issue.

Once I get to Fairlight, nothing happens. No playback. Anyone else have this issue? I'm on Win 7 SP1

win7 isn't supported, but some are getting it to run. don't know about audio on win7 .

Things to try. make sure your audio device is set to 48000hz. if its different, Fairlight wont work.
make sure the mute button on the color page isn't selected - in first beta there was nothing on the fairlight page to show its muted (haven't tested in 14.b2 yet)

It's unlikely Win7 is your problem. Unless BMD is not revealing all it knows, there are no documented conflicts between Win7 and Resolve, beyond the inability of Resolve to play certain h.264 formats (which Win7 can itself play in other apps). So far, there's no indication this is any different with v14.

I have no trouble with audio playback on the Fairlight page (under Win7).

Another known Win7/Resolve issue is that Advanced Panels don't work under Win7 on multiple (but not all) hardware platforms.
